Abstract

 
The present study was conducted using an analytical-applied approach aimed to provide strategies for the development of the agriculture sector using multi-criteria decision-making techniques in the coasts of Hormozgan Province for integrated coastal zone management. For this purpose, in this study, first the internal and external strategic factors of the study area were identified, then through SWOT matrix possible strategies were provided, using the network analysis process (ANP) the strategies provided were weighted and finally the most important strategies were prioritized. The results of the implementation of the integrated SWOT-ANP method in this study showed that the strategies to present a comprehensive agricultural management plan to prevent the negative impacts of pollutants on sensitive coastal zones, provide special rules and regulations to protect the environment, and water and soil resources and prevent the destruction of agricultural lands through decisions and implementation of land use change plans, use of native plants and trees while adapting to the climate of the region to maintain the ecological sustainability of the region, using ecological potential and other potentials of the coast in the region to develop agriculture as a capacity in the region, which are among WT strategies due to minimizing the damage caused by weaknesses and threats, were considered as the best strategies and WO strategies due to the use of advantages of opportunities to compensate for the weaknesses in the region were the next priority of coastal agriculture development strategies in Hormozgan Province.
